The Hype Behind Pentakill's "Lost Chapter"
Pentakill's "Lost Chapter" isn't just another album release; it's a full-blown event in the League of Legends universe and beyond. This virtual metal band, featuring champions from the game, has cultivated a dedicated following that eagerly anticipates every new track and lore expansion. But what exactly fuels this massive hype? It all boils down to a combination of factors that resonate deeply with gamers and music enthusiasts alike.
First and foremost, there’s the undeniable quality of the music. Pentakill's sound is a potent blend of power metal, progressive metal, and symphonic elements, crafted by talented musicians and composers. Each song tells a story, weaving intricate narratives that tie into the League of Legends universe while standing alone as compelling musical pieces. The production value is top-notch, rivaling that of real-world metal bands, which adds to the authenticity and appeal. The "Grasp of the Undying" Meme
One of the most popular memes to emerge from the "Lost Chapter" release was the "Grasp of the Undying" meme, inspired by a lyric from one of the new songs. Fans took the phrase and applied it to various everyday situations, creating humorous scenarios where someone stubbornly clings to something, refusing to let go. The meme quickly spread across social media, becoming a shorthand for stubbornness and determination.
The "Grasp of the Undying" meme resonated with fans because it was relatable and easily adaptable to different contexts.
